Specifically, with regard to the Comprehensive Plan, the Planning. <br />Commission has. the following major responsibilities: (a) to <br />periodically review (not less frequently than biannually) and make <br />suggested additions and amendments to the Comprehensive Plan, (b) <br />to assure that all provisions of the. City's development control <br />ordinances (or proposed amendments or additions to these <br />ordinances) are in accordance with the principles of the plan, (c) to <br />review proposed public capital investments.of the City of Gem.Lake. <br />to determine their consistency with the Comprehensive Plan and (d) <br />to review proposed private capital investments' within Gem Lake to <br />assure that they are in accordance with the principles and proposals <br />of the plan. While the Planning Commission's responsibilities are <br />primarily advisory the City Council has prime authority in carrying <br />out the plan's features — the Planning Commission nevertheless is <br />considered to be the City's primary body in terms of making explicit <br />interpretations of the plan's stated proposals. <br />2.3 Use of the Plan by the City Council <br />The City Council is a five -member body directly elected by the <br />citizens of Gem Lake. Council members are elected to four year <br />staggered terms and the Mayor is elected to a 2-year term. As the <br />primarypolicy making body of the City of Gem Lake, the Council has <br />the following principal. responsibilities in relation to. the <br />Comprehensive Municipal Plan: (a) to assure, to the maximum extent <br />possible, that the policies contained within the Comprehensive Plan <br />document represent the viewpoint of the citizens of the community, <br />(b) to attempt to make in policy decisions in normal council <br />deliberations that are consistent with the plan's provisions, (c) to <br />make public capital expenditures and. related expenditures consistent <br />with the principles of the plan, and (d) to exercise the ultimate review <br />and adoption of all original plan provisions and amendments to the <br />plan forwarded to the Council by the Planning Commission. <br />2.4 Relationship of Other Municipal Bodies and Citizens. <br />to the Plan <br />Beyond guiding the actions of the City Planning Commission and the <br />City Council, the plan is designed to be an educational device <br />designed to convey to all people in Gem Lake the manner in which <br />the City is desired to develop. The plan is intended to convey the. <br />unique assets, liabilities, and key development issues facing the. City <br />in the coming, years. Citizens interested in interpretations of the, <br />provisions of the Comprehensive Municipal Plan, or revisions to it,: <br />are encouraged to meet with the Planning Commission at its regularly <br />scheduled sessions. <br />Comprehensive Plan. <br />Gem Lake, Minnesota Page 4 <br />
